Tongits — sometimes spelled Tong-Its — is a three-player card game that originated in the Philippines and has been part of everyday Filipino life for generations. The basic objective is the same as the classic game: form valid card combinations (sets and sequences) in your hand, and be the first to empty your hand or hold the lowest unmatched card total when the game ends. Sounds simple, but experienced Tongits players know the real depth is in the bluffing, the timing of your draw-or-pass decisions, and knowing when to call a "Tong-its" challenge.

The highest win condition. You empty your entire hand by melding all cards into valid sets and runs. When you Tongits, you win automatically without needing a showdown — maximum payout at joinph's Tongits Go tables.
Instant WinLay down valid combinations from your hand onto the table. Sets are three or more cards of the same rank (e.g., three Queens). Runs are three or more cards of the same suit in sequence (e.g., 7-8-9 of hearts). The more melds you lay, the lower your deadwood count.
Core MechanicAny player can call a challenge at any time, forcing all players to compare unmatched card totals. The player with the lowest deadwood wins. Timing your challenge correctly is one of Tongits' most critical skills — call too early and you might lose to a better-positioned opponent.
Strategic MoveIf you cannot or choose not to draw a card, you pass your turn. This is called a Burn or Pasada. Over-burning signals a weak hand to opponents — use sparingly and deliberately to avoid giving away your position at the table.
Turn OptionWhen the draw pile is exhausted and no one has declared Tongits, the game ends and all players compare their unmatched card deadwood. The player holding the lowest total wins. This outcome is common at higher-stakes joinph tables where all three players are playing defensively.

Advanced Play| Card | Deadwood Value | Notes |
|---|---|---|
| Ace (A) | 1 point | Lowest deadwood card |
| 2 – 9 | Face value | E.g., 7 of spades = 7 points |
| 10, Jack, Queen, King | 10 points each | High deadwood — meld or discard fast |

The discard pile tells you exactly what your opponents cannot use. If two Kings have already been discarded, holding onto your King becomes deadwood — dump it immediately and lighten your hand count.
Laying your melds face-up signals your hand strength. Experienced joinph Tongits Go players often hold back a completed meld to disguise their deadwood total and prevent opponents from challenging at the wrong moment.
Track what each opponent has melded versus what they're still holding. If a player has only melds on the table and hasn't drawn for two turns, their remaining hand is probably small — that's your signal to consider a challenge before they declare Tongits.
The challenge is the most powerful move in Tongits. Call it when you are confident your deadwood is the lowest at the table. Don't challenge just because you can — a well-timed challenge after an aggressive draw phase can steal a pot from a player one card away from Tongits.
